1. Ameriflight owns Wiggins. Run separately though. If you want to work at MHT apply to Wiggins solely.

2. Money at Ameriflight goes E120, B1900/Metro, 99/PA31 E120 FO. You can stay at a base and move to other aircraft as long as there is a spot open (and you have been in that airplane for at least 6 months).

3. No degree required and they wouldn't notice anyway

4. Yes you could, not 100% on the process but I believe how well you do in training will reflect if they offer it to you later on.

5. It's unrealistic unless you're an E120 Captain and you accrue some other bonuses, training captain etc. Start is $65K

Hope that helps
